What Does Quiet Hours Mean On Airbnb?

Quiet hours at Airbnbs are designated hours during the evening and early hours of the morning.

These hours are determined by the host and are typically between 9 pm to 7 am.

During these hours guests are required to keep their noise levels down. 

Quiet hours are put in place so that other parties in the house, including the host and other guests, are not disturbed at inconvenient hours.

Hosts generally offer some sort of guidelines to define what they mean by quiet hours.

Some hosts may simply request that voices and TV or music volumes be lowered.

Others may request that noisy activities, such as washing dishes, be avoided altogether. 

What Are Airbnb House Rules?

Airbnb house rules are regulations put in place by the hosts or short-term property managers.

These are provided in order to give the hosting party control over how their guests use their facilities.

House rules need to be stipulated on the listing profile.

They also need to be agreed to by the potential guests before making any requests for reservation. 

Examples Of Other Types Of House Rules

There are a number of things that might be stipulated in the house rules of an Airbnb listing.

These are put in place to cover all bases and keep both the houseguest and the host happy during the stay.

Aside from designated quiet hours, there are other kinds of house rules that hosts may implement.

These may include the following: 

  • No eating or drinking in the bedrooms
  • No pets or pets allowed
  • No smoking
  • No parties or events
  • No unregistered guests 
  • Use of the pool area is allowed 
  • Use of the barbeque is allowed 
  • Dishes should be washed and set to dry 
  • Kids should be accompanied whilst on the balcony

Other common topics that should be addressed in the house rules include: 

  • Check-in and check-out times
  • Curfew 
  • Parking 
  • Access to different parts of the property 
  • Security 
  • Shoes inside 
  • Recycling and garbage 
  • Neighborhood requirements 
  • Laundry 
  • Eating areas 
  • Use of the facilities 
  • Damages and breakages 
  • Emergency contact details 

Conclusion

House rules are an important part of an Airbnb listing profile.

They set the tone and conduct the host of the facility is expecting.

Going through the house rules of a listing is a key part of choosing an appropriate host house for yourself. 

Look out for certain house rules that do not suit your lifestyle. If you are a bit of a night owl and like to have dinner between 8 pm and 9 pm, a listing with a curfew of 9 pm will not suit you.

House rules are not stipulated to be a pain for the guests, but rather to avoid any misunderstandings between the host and the guests.
